Need a online presence that truly impacts? A talented web design agency in Leeds is your key. We focus on crafting modern websites that are both aesthetically pleasing and functionally robust. From initial concept to https://kallumotkg981662.gynoblog.com/31177176/top-rated-leeds-web-design-agency